Question 1 of 10
1. Question
Governance review demonstrates a critical care specialist is managing a patient experiencing acute, severe hypotension and signs of end-organ hypoperfusion, indicative of a shock syndrome. The specialist must rapidly determine the most appropriate initial management strategy. Which of the following approaches best reflects current best practices in advanced cardiopulmonary critical care?
Correct
Scenario Analysis: This scenario is professionally challenging due to the inherent complexity of managing advanced cardiopulmonary pathophysiology and shock syndromes in a critical care setting. The rapid deterioration of a patient, coupled with the need for immediate, life-saving interventions, places immense pressure on the specialist. Ethical considerations regarding patient autonomy, resource allocation, and the duty of care are paramount. The specialist must navigate uncertainty, interpret subtle clinical cues, and make high-stakes decisions under duress, all while adhering to established best practices and institutional protocols. Correct Approach Analysis: The best professional practice involves a systematic, evidence-based approach that prioritizes immediate hemodynamic stabilization and organ perfusion while simultaneously investigating the underlying etiology of the shock. This includes initiating broad-spectrum resuscitation with fluids and vasopressors as indicated by hemodynamic monitoring, while concurrently obtaining diagnostic data such as arterial blood gases, lactate levels, and echocardiography to guide further management. This approach is correct because it directly addresses the immediate life threat of inadequate tissue perfusion, a core principle in critical care medicine, and aligns with established guidelines for managing shock states. It reflects a commitment to patient safety and optimal outcomes by acting decisively while gathering information to refine the treatment strategy. Incorrect Approaches Analysis: An approach that delays definitive management of shock to pursue exhaustive diagnostic workups without initiating resuscitation is professionally unacceptable. This failure to act promptly in the face of hemodynamic instability can lead to irreversible organ damage and increased mortality. It violates the ethical principle of beneficence by not acting in the patient’s best interest to preserve life and function. An approach that relies solely on empirical treatment without considering the specific pathophysiology of the shock syndrome is also professionally unacceptable. While initial resuscitation is crucial, failing to investigate the underlying cause (e.g., cardiogenic, septic, hypovolemic, obstructive) can lead to inappropriate or ineffective interventions, potentially exacerbating the patient’s condition. This demonstrates a lack of critical thinking and adherence to evidence-based practice. An approach that prioritizes comfort measures over aggressive resuscitation in a potentially reversible shock state is professionally unacceptable, unless a clear advance directive or family consensus dictates otherwise. While respecting patient wishes is vital, abandoning life-sustaining interventions prematurely without exploring all viable treatment options constitutes a failure of the duty of care. Professional Reasoning: Professionals should employ a structured decision-making process that begins with rapid assessment of the patient’s hemodynamic status and signs of end-organ hypoperfusion. This should be followed by immediate initiation of empiric resuscitation measures guided by available monitoring. Concurrently, a focused diagnostic workup should be pursued to identify the specific etiology of the shock. Treatment should then be tailored to the identified cause, with continuous reassessment and adjustment of the therapeutic plan based on the patient’s response. This iterative process ensures that immediate life threats are addressed while working towards a definitive resolution of the underlying problem.

Question 3 of 10
3. Question
Stakeholder feedback indicates a critical care physician is faced with a rapidly deteriorating patient requiring immediate mechanical ventilation and consideration for extracorporeal membrane oxygenation (ECMO). The patient has a history of a serious illness and has previously expressed strong preferences regarding life-sustaining treatments in such scenarios, but their current capacity to communicate or make decisions is unclear due to their acute condition. Which of the following actions best represents the ethically and legally sound approach to managing this complex situation?
Correct
Scenario Analysis: This scenario is professionally challenging because it requires balancing the immediate, life-sustaining needs of a critically ill patient with the ethical imperative of shared decision-making and respecting patient autonomy, even when the patient’s capacity is compromised. The rapid deterioration and the need for aggressive interventions like mechanical ventilation and extracorporeal therapies necessitate swift action, but this must not override the established principles of informed consent and patient rights. The complexity of the technology involved, coupled with the patient’s critical state, adds layers of technical and ethical consideration. Correct Approach Analysis: The best approach involves a comprehensive assessment of the patient’s capacity to make decisions, followed by a structured discussion with the designated surrogate decision-maker. This approach prioritizes obtaining informed consent for the proposed mechanical ventilation and extracorporeal therapies, ensuring that the surrogate understands the risks, benefits, alternatives, and prognosis. This aligns with fundamental ethical principles of autonomy and beneficence, as well as legal requirements for consent in medical treatment. It respects the patient’s right to self-determination, even when exercised through a surrogate. Incorrect Approaches Analysis: One incorrect approach is to proceed with mechanical ventilation and extracorporeal therapies without a thorough assessment of the patient’s capacity or engaging the surrogate decision-maker. This bypasses the essential requirement for informed consent, violating the patient’s right to autonomy and potentially leading to treatment that is not aligned with their values or wishes. It also fails to uphold the legal and ethical obligations to involve the patient’s chosen representative in critical care decisions. Another incorrect approach is to delay necessary life-sustaining interventions while attempting to definitively establish the patient’s capacity, especially if the patient is rapidly deteriorating. While capacity assessment is crucial, in a life-threatening emergency, a pragmatic approach to surrogate decision-making may be necessary to prevent irreversible harm or death. Prolonged indecision in the face of immediate peril can be detrimental. A third incorrect approach is to unilaterally decide on the course of treatment based solely on the medical team’s judgment of what is “best” for the patient, without adequately involving the surrogate decision-maker or attempting to ascertain the patient’s prior wishes. This paternalistic approach disregards the patient’s right to participate in their own care and the legal and ethical standing of the surrogate. Professional Reasoning: Professionals should employ a tiered decision-making process. First, assess the patient’s capacity. If capacity is present, engage the patient directly. If capacity is impaired, identify and engage the legally recognized surrogate decision-maker. Document all discussions, assessments, and decisions meticulously. In emergent situations where immediate intervention is life-saving, proceed with necessary stabilization while concurrently initiating the process of capacity assessment and surrogate engagement. If there is a conflict or uncertainty, seek ethical consultation or legal guidance. The guiding principle is to act in the patient’s best interest while upholding their rights and respecting their values, as far as they can be known or determined.

Question 4 of 10
4. Question
Strategic planning requires a comprehensive approach to managing sedation, analgesia, delirium prevention, and neuroprotection in critically ill transplant recipients. Considering the unique vulnerabilities of these patients and the evolving landscape of critical care, which of the following approaches best aligns with current best practices and ethical considerations?
Correct
Scenario Analysis: Managing sedation, analgesia, delirium prevention, and neuroprotection in critically ill transplant patients presents a complex ethical and clinical challenge. These patients are often highly vulnerable due to their underlying condition, the immunosuppressive regimen, and the acute critical illness. Balancing the need for patient comfort and safety with the potential for adverse effects of interventions, such as respiratory depression or prolonged delirium, requires meticulous assessment and individualized care. Furthermore, the rapid evolution of critical care medicine and the specific physiological considerations for transplant recipients necessitate adherence to best practices and evolving guidelines. Correct Approach Analysis: The best professional practice involves a multidisciplinary approach that prioritizes individualized, evidence-based care. This approach necessitates a thorough initial assessment of the patient’s pain, anxiety, and delirium risk, followed by the selection of appropriate pharmacological agents and non-pharmacological strategies tailored to the patient’s specific transplant type, organ function, and overall clinical status. Continuous reassessment of the patient’s response to interventions, including regular sedation vacations and delirium screening, is crucial. This aligns with ethical principles of beneficence and non-maleficence, ensuring that interventions are both beneficial and minimize harm. It also reflects the professional responsibility to stay abreast of and apply current clinical guidelines and best practices in critical care and transplant medicine, which emphasize patient-centered care and minimizing iatrogenic complications. Incorrect Approaches Analysis: A standardized, one-size-fits-all approach to sedation and analgesia, without considering individual patient factors or transplant-specific needs, is professionally unacceptable. This fails to acknowledge the unique pharmacokinetics and pharmacodynamics that may be altered in transplant recipients, potentially leading to over-sedation or under-treatment of pain and anxiety. Such an approach risks violating the principle of individualized care and could result in adverse outcomes, including prolonged mechanical ventilation and increased risk of delirium. Relying solely on pharmacological interventions without incorporating non-pharmacological strategies, such as environmental modifications, early mobilization (where appropriate), and family involvement, represents a significant ethical and clinical failing. This overlooks the holistic nature of critical care and the established benefits of multimodal approaches in managing pain, anxiety, and delirium. It can lead to increased reliance on sedatives and analgesics, with their associated risks, and may not adequately address the underlying causes of distress or agitation. Failing to regularly reassess the patient’s level of sedation, pain, and presence of delirium, and to adjust interventions accordingly, is also professionally unacceptable. This static approach ignores the dynamic nature of critical illness and the potential for interventions to become ineffective or harmful over time. It can lead to prolonged sedation, increased risk of ventilator-associated pneumonia, and a higher incidence of post-intensive care syndrome, including persistent cognitive impairment. Professional Reasoning: Professionals should adopt a systematic decision-making process that begins with a comprehensive assessment of the patient’s needs and risks. This should be followed by the development of an individualized care plan that integrates pharmacological and non-pharmacological interventions. Continuous monitoring and reassessment are paramount, with a willingness to adapt the plan based on the patient’s response and evolving clinical status. Collaboration with the multidisciplinary team, including physicians, nurses, pharmacists, and respiratory therapists, is essential to ensure optimal patient outcomes. Ethical considerations, such as patient autonomy (where applicable), beneficence, non-maleficence, and justice, should guide all decision-making.

Question 9 of 10
9. Question
Operational review demonstrates a critical care transplant team is managing a patient with a rare, life-threatening post-transplant complication for which standard treatment protocols have proven ineffective. The team identifies a potential novel therapeutic intervention, not yet widely approved or standard of care for this specific complication, which shows promise in early research. What is the most appropriate clinical and professional approach to managing this situation?
Correct
The scenario presents a common yet complex challenge in transplant critical care: managing a patient with a rare, potentially life-threatening complication post-transplant, where standard protocols are insufficient and novel interventions are being considered. The professional challenge lies in balancing the urgent need to save the patient’s life with the ethical and regulatory obligations to ensure patient safety, informed consent, and responsible use of experimental treatments. This requires a deep understanding of clinical judgment, ethical principles, and the regulatory landscape governing novel therapies. The best approach involves a comprehensive, multidisciplinary discussion and a structured process for evaluating and potentially implementing an off-label or experimental treatment. This includes a thorough review of the available scientific literature, consultation with experts in the specific transplant specialty and the rare complication, and a detailed assessment of the potential risks and benefits for the individual patient. Crucially, this approach mandates obtaining fully informed consent from the patient or their legal surrogate, ensuring they understand the experimental nature of the proposed treatment, its potential outcomes, and alternatives. This aligns with fundamental ethical principles of beneficence, non-maleficence, and patient autonomy, as well as regulatory frameworks that require rigorous evaluation and documentation for non-standard treatments, particularly those involving investigational drugs or procedures. The process emphasizes transparency, collaboration, and patient-centered decision-making. An approach that bypasses a formal multidisciplinary review and relies solely on the attending physician’s experience, even if extensive, is professionally unacceptable. This fails to leverage the collective expertise available within a transplant center, potentially overlooking critical insights or alternative perspectives that could improve patient outcomes or identify unforeseen risks. It also risks violating ethical principles of shared decision-making and potentially regulatory requirements for documenting the rationale and approval process for non-standard care. Another professionally unacceptable approach is to proceed with the novel intervention without obtaining explicit, fully informed consent from the patient or their surrogate. This directly contravenes the ethical imperative of patient autonomy and the legal requirement for informed consent. Patients have the right to understand the nature of their treatment, its potential benefits and harms, and to make voluntary decisions about their care, especially when experimental or off-label therapies are involved. Finally, an approach that prioritizes the immediate administration of the novel therapy to avoid perceived delays, without adequately documenting the rationale, risks, and benefits, or without ensuring appropriate oversight, is also professionally unsound. While urgency is a factor in critical care, it does not negate the need for a structured, ethical, and regulatory-compliant decision-making process. This can lead to suboptimal care, potential harm, and regulatory non-compliance. Professionals should employ a decision-making framework that begins with a thorough assessment of the clinical situation and the limitations of standard care. This should be followed by a collaborative consultation process involving relevant specialists, ethical review, and a detailed risk-benefit analysis. The cornerstone of this process is open and honest communication with the patient and their surrogate, ensuring they are empowered to participate in decisions about their care. Documentation throughout this process is paramount for accountability and continuous quality improvement.

Question 10 of 10
10. Question
Cost-benefit analysis shows that investing in advanced critical care resources for transplant patients yields significant long-term benefits. However, during a period of high demand and limited ICU bed availability, a critically ill transplant patient requires immediate transfer to an ICU bed with specialized ventilator support. The transplant team strongly advocates for immediate transfer, citing the patient’s complex post-transplant needs and the potential for rapid deterioration. The critical care team, however, is managing several other patients with equally critical, life-threatening conditions who are also awaiting ICU beds. What is the most appropriate course of action for the medical team to ensure ethical and effective resource allocation?
Correct
The scenario presents a common challenge in transplant critical care: balancing resource allocation with patient advocacy and the ethical imperative to provide the best possible care. The professional challenge lies in navigating the inherent scarcity of critical care resources, such as ventilators and specialized nursing staff, against the urgent and often life-saving needs of critically ill transplant patients. This requires careful judgment, adherence to established protocols, and a commitment to equitable and transparent decision-making. The best approach involves a comprehensive, multidisciplinary assessment that prioritizes objective clinical criteria and established institutional guidelines for resource allocation. This approach ensures that decisions are based on medical necessity, likelihood of benefit, and patient prognosis, rather than subjective factors or external pressures. It aligns with ethical principles of justice and beneficence, ensuring that resources are distributed fairly and to those who are most likely to benefit. Furthermore, transparent communication with the patient’s family about the decision-making process, even when difficult, is crucial for maintaining trust and upholding patient dignity. This method is supported by ethical guidelines that emphasize fairness, proportionality, and the avoidance of discrimination in healthcare resource allocation. An incorrect approach would be to solely advocate for the transplant patient’s immediate access to all requested resources without considering the needs of other critically ill patients. This fails to acknowledge the reality of resource limitations and the ethical obligation to consider the broader patient population. It can lead to inequitable distribution and potentially divert resources from patients who might have a higher likelihood of survival or benefit from those specific interventions, violating the principle of justice. Another incorrect approach would be to defer the decision entirely to the transplant team without engaging in a broader discussion with the critical care team and ethics committee. While the transplant team’s expertise is vital, resource allocation decisions in critical care often require a broader perspective that considers the overall hospital capacity and the needs of all patients. This siloed decision-making can lead to suboptimal outcomes for the hospital as a whole and may not adhere to institutional policies for critical care resource management. A further incorrect approach would be to prioritize the patient based on their transplant status alone, irrespective of their current clinical condition or prognosis. While successful transplantation is a significant achievement, it does not automatically confer a higher claim to scarce critical care resources if their current clinical trajectory suggests a poor outcome or if other patients have a more immediate and potentially reversible need. This can be seen as discriminatory and fails to uphold the principle of medical need. Professionals should employ a decision-making framework that begins with a thorough clinical assessment of the patient’s current condition, prognosis, and potential benefit from the requested resources. This should be followed by a review of institutional policies and guidelines for critical care resource allocation. Engaging in a multidisciplinary discussion involving the critical care team, transplant team, and potentially an ethics committee is essential for a balanced and ethical decision. Transparent communication with the patient’s family, explaining the rationale behind the decision, is paramount, even when the outcome is not what the family desires.
